Marvel’s Spider-Man 2’s emphasis on highlighting both of Insomniac’s Spider-Men, Peter Parker and Miles Morales, is apparent in the game’s official announcement trailer. But with the confirmation thatMarvel’s Spider-Manwill be singleplayer, fans have speculated on how Insomniac could weave both characters together in gameplay.

Miles, as well as Mary Jane Watson, received intermittentstealth-oriented sequences inMarvel’s Spider-Manthat let players learn more about him and play from a unique perspective where their character lacked Spider-Man’s abilities and gadgets. However, because Miles has grown into his role as Spider-Man in his own standalone title, that will no longer be an option for his character. Recently, one fan has offered an idea that would take from a highly successful narrative blueprint that Naughty Dog has previously employed.

Reddit user sunbatherzero suggests thatMarvel’s Spider-Man 2could instate unique paths for each character that may intersect at determined moments, but are otherwise separate and deal with different characters or enemies, similar toThe Last of Us 2’splayable protagonists' interwoven arcs.The Last of Us 2establishes a surprise shift in character perspective when Abby becomes playable, once briefly outside of Jackson and then for a prolonged period after a climactic moment in Seattle.

Abby’s gameplay inThe Last of Us 2is not half-baked and players may have been alarmed to see opportunities for several of her own upgrade skill branches become available. Abby’s breadth of gameplay demonstrates that players will spend time with her that is comparable to how much time they previously spent with Ellie, particularly because Abby’s narrative takes place within the same span of days. If Peter and Miles shared screen time this way, sunbatherzero believes their “intersecting arcs” could be satisfying.

Another more likely option, suggested by bshively, is that Insomniac may dip into its own protagonist swap feature that was implemented with Ratchet and Rivet inRatchet and Clank: Rift Apart.Ratchet and Clank: Rift Apartlets players eventually swap back and forth from Ratchet and Rivet in scripted missions on specific planets with the two separated at all times as a result. However, an open-world Manhattan throws a wrench intoRatchet and Clank: Rift Apart’s mission-select featureunless players choose which character to freely roam as.

Marvel’s Spider-Man: Miles Moralesafforded players with less gadgets in turn for remarkable bioelectric powers that would be fitting of their own upgrade branches in a sequel. IfMarvel’s Spider-Man 2plans to truly develop both characters as playable protagonists, fans ultimately wish that they will each have significant narratives and gameplay that are unique to each character’s abilities, sensibilities, and identities.

Marvel’s Spider-Man 2is currently in development for the PS5.
